So back to our road trip to Nana’s. We loaded back in and got comfy again. Everyone dosed off and I was able to see them in the built-in backseat mirror.  I set the cruise control once I got on I-75. It took me a few minutes to realize the cruise control wasn’t broken it was the amazing adaptive cruise control. 

Push Button Start

I almost didn’t return to the vehicle for this feature alone!  If a slower car gets in front of you when you’re using the cruise control it will automatically keep a safe distance (you can select the distance on the steering wheel) and slow you down. Once the car gets back over it sped back up to my original set speed.  Super cool feature.
